King Kylie Dunkin Menu: Every New Pink Drink, Explained

Dunkin’ just turned its entire summer lineup pink, and the name behind it isn’t a flavor scientist — it’s Kylie Jenner. On July 8, 2026, the chain rolled out The King Kylie™ Collection nationwide, a three-drink lineup built around the exact aesthetic Jenner made famous a decade ago: hot pink, unapologetic, a little chaotic in the best way. It landed alongside a much bigger wave of new drinks and bakery items, so if you walked into a Dunkin’ this week and felt like the menu board suddenly had twice as much on it, you weren’t imagining things Dunkin’ confirmed the full lineup in its official King Kylie Collection announcement.

Here’s everything that’s new, what’s actually in each drink, and where the “King Kylie” name even comes from — because that context is the difference between ordering blind and ordering like you know exactly what you’re getting into.

What Is The King Kylie™ Collection?

Three drinks, one color story. Dunkin’ built this collection around Jenner’s so-called “King Kylie” era — roughly 2014 to 2016, when her Instagram handle was literally @kingkylie and her whole look was colorful wigs, heavy makeup, and streetwear that had nothing to do with subtlety. That nickname partly grew out of her relationship with rapper Tyga, who went by “King Gold Chains” at the time. A decade later, Jenner revived the branding herself with a 10th-anniversary King Kylie makeup collection through Kylie Cosmetics in late 2025 — and this Dunkin’ partnership is the direct sequel to that.

The three drinks:

  • Candy Pink Lemonade Refresher– — Pink Pineapple flavor mixed with lemonade, layered with dragonfruit pieces
  • Vanilla Pink Cloud Latte — espresso and whole milk with French vanilla flavor, finished with Strawberry Cold Foam
  • Pink Lemon Drop Suncloud Lemonade — lemonade built on oat milk, topped with the same Strawberry Cold Foam

All three drinks are available for a limited time at participating Dunkin’ locations. Customers can order them in-store or through the app starting July 8.

Moreover, Jenner played an active role in the collaboration instead of simply licensing her name. She told The Hollywood Reporter that she reviewed an early creative concept, described it as “very King Kylie, very pink,” and joined several creative discussions before the collection took its final shape. Meanwhile, Dunkin’ supported the launch with a commercial directed by Dave Meyers, in which Jenner plays a boardroom executive whose entire agenda is “serving pink this summer.” As a result, the campaign builds on the same boardroom-humor style that has worked well for the brand in the past.

Why This Isn’t Dunkin’s First Pink Rodeo

If the strawberry cold foam and hot-pink branding feel familiar, that’s because Dunkin’ ran a Barbie collaboration not long before this one, which is where Strawberry Cold Foam and a similar palette of vanilla-and-strawberry drinks first showed up. King Kylie leans into the same visual playbook but swaps Barbie’s plastic-doll aesthetic for Jenner’s grungier, streetwear-coded pink — different mood, same core idea: pink sells in summer 2026.

It also lines up with a broader 2016 revival that’s been building since late 2025 — old Zara Larsson and Justin Bieber tracks resurfacing, Pokémon Go trending again, filters and formats from that era making a comeback on Instagram and Snapchat. Dunkin’ didn’t invent the nostalgia wave. It just found a very caffeinated way to ride it.

The Rest Of The Summer Menu (It’s Bigger Than Three Drinks)

The King Kylie trio is the headline, but Dunkin’ quietly dropped thirteen-plus other new items the same day. If you’re building a full summer order, here’s what else joined the board.

New lemonades and sparkling drinks:

  • Suncloud Lemonade — lemonade with Strawberry Cold Foam, caffeine-free
  • Strawberry Suncloud Lemonade — strawberry flavor, lemonade, oat milk, Strawberry Cold Foam
  • Freeze Pop Suncloud Lemonade
  • Coconut Suncloud Limeade
  • Sparkling Lemonade
  • Strawberry Sparkling Limeade
  • Matcha Lemonade
  • Watermelon Lime Dunkin’ Zero — watermelon lime syrup and sparkling water, no caffeine

Peanut butter and Fluffernutter lineup:

  • Fluffernutter Cloud Latte — peanut butter flavor, espresso, whole milk, Marshmallow Cold Foam
  • PB&J Cloud Latte — peanut butter flavor, espresso, whole milk, Strawberry Cold Foam
  • Fluffernutter Coffee Chiller — frozen coffee, peanut butter, Marshmallow Cold Foam, whipped cream, caramel drizzle
  • Peanut Butter Protein Latte — 17 grams of protein in a medium
  • Peanut Butter Shakin’ Espresso
  • Chocolate Covered Strawberry Iced Coffee

Bakery additions:

  • Ice Cream Cake Flavored Donut — yeast shell, chocolate buttercreme filling, vanilla buttercreme topping, chocolate cookie crunch coating, served in its own individual donut box
  • Chocolate Crunch MUNCHKINS® — glazed chocolate cake Munchkins rolled in chocolate cookie crunch

One thing worth clearing up since people keep asking: the Peanut Swirl flavor doesn’t actually contain peanuts, according to Dunkin’s own FAQ on the launch — worth knowing if you’re ordering around an allergy.

Rewards Members Get Extra Reasons To Order

Dunkin’ stacked a run of bonus-point promos on top of the menu launch, all through Dunkin’ Rewards:

DatesOffer
July 6 – Aug 1750 bonus points/day (up to 150/week) on order-ahead through the app, weekdays only
July 194x points on donuts and Munchkins (National Ice Cream Day)
July 213x points on any Refreshers purchase
July 234x points on Lemonade
July 25100 bonus points via drive-thru or app order-ahead (Drive-Thru Day)
July 26 – Aug 8Boosted Members: 3x points on any beverage after 1 p.m.

The $6 Meal Deal (coffee plus two wraps), Golden BBQ Hash Brown Wake-Up Wrap®, and Loaded Hash Browns all stay on the menu alongside the new items, so this isn’t a lineup swap — it’s an addition.

FAQ

What is Dunkin’s King Kylie Collection? A limited-time trio of pink drinks — Candy Pink Lemonade Refresher, Vanilla Pink Cloud Latte, and Pink Lemon Drop Suncloud Lemonade — created with Kylie Jenner and inspired by her mid-2010s “King Kylie” persona.

When did the King Kylie menu launch? July 8, 2026, nationwide at participating Dunkin’ locations, in-store and on the app.

Is the King Kylie Collection permanent? No. Dunkin’ has labeled it limited-time, in line with how the chain typically runs seasonal and collaboration menus.

Does the Peanut Swirl contain peanuts? No — Dunkin’ confirmed the Peanut Swirl flavor does not actually contain peanuts.

What does “King Kylie” mean? It’s the nickname and Instagram persona Kylie Jenner used from around 2014–2016, marked by colorful wigs, bold makeup, and streetwear. She revived the branding through a 2025 Kylie Cosmetics anniversary collection before this Dunkin’ collaboration.

Are the King Kylie drinks caffeinated? The Vanilla Pink Cloud Latte runs on espresso. The Candy Pink Lemonade Refresher and Pink Lemon Drop Suncloud Lemonade are lemonade-based; check with your location on caffeine content if that matters for your order.
